Intelligent lock structure for public leasing bicycle
Technical Field
The invention belongs to the technical field of public management of bicycles, and particularly relates to an intelligent lock structure for a public rental bicycle.
Background
The existing public leasing bicycle is parked in a special parking area and locked by a parking column. Because most parking areas are built in places with a lot of people's flows, the use frequency of the public leasing bicycle is high, great convenience is brought to the travel of people, and the locking mechanism is an important component of the public leasing bicycle, if the locking is improper, the bicycle is easy to lose, the public use experience is also poor, the operation of the public leasing bicycle is influenced, and bad influence exists on the management and the use of the public leasing bicycle, so the locking mechanism must be reliable, convenient and fast.
Disclosure of Invention
The invention aims to solve at least one technical defect, and provides an intelligent lock structure for a public leasing bicycle, which has the advantages of simple structure, good reliability, low electricity consumption and the like.
The technical scheme of the invention is as follows: an intelligent lock structure for public leasing bicycle is arranged in a bicycle fixed column of a public leasing bicycle parking place, the bicycle fixed column is provided with an IC card area and an ECU control system, the IC card area is electrically connected with the ECU control system, the public leasing bicycle is provided with a locking plate on a front wheel fork, wherein the intelligent lock structure is provided with a supporting plate, a locking mechanism and a driving mechanism, the locking mechanism is movably connected with the supporting plate, the driving mechanism is arranged on the supporting plate and electrically connected with the ECU control system, the locking plate of the public leasing bicycle is inserted into the locking mechanism, and the driving mechanism drives the locking mechanism to lock the public leasing bicycle.
The locking plate of the bicycle is inserted into the locking mechanism, a user swipes an IC card in the IC card area, and the ECU control system controls the driving mechanism to lock the locking mechanism, so that the public rental bicycle is locked.
Further, locking mechanism includes spring bolt, spring bolt spacing taper pin, limit switch, spring bolt spacing armature, and spring bolt spacing armature is connected with actuating mechanism, and the spring bolt is equipped with branch, and the spring bolt passes through branch and backup pad to be connected, and the spring bolt passes through pivot pin and branch swing joint, and spring bolt spacing taper pin and spring bolt fixed connection, limit switch installs on the bicycle fixed column. The external force that produces when locking plate inserts the spring bolt makes the spring bolt inwards rotate through the pivot pin, contacts limit switch simultaneously, makes limit switch close, and the user carries out the IC punching card, and actuating mechanism drives down spring bolt limit armature, and spring bolt limit armature and the contact of spring bolt spacing taper pin produce frictional force and make the spring bolt can not remove to lock the bicycle.
Further, the lock tongue is provided with a boss, the boss is provided with a locking groove, and the locking plate is inserted into the locking groove to lock the public rental bicycle. The locking groove is matched with the locking plate better, so that the bicycle is locked more firmly.
Further, a spring is arranged between the lock tongue and the support plate. The spring plays a role of keeping the lock tongue in a keeping state,
further, the driving mechanism comprises a push-pull electromagnetic valve. The push-pull electromagnetic valve is used as a driving mechanism, so that the device is quick and efficient, the driving effect is strong, and the positioning is accurate.
Further, be equipped with U type deflector in the backup pad, U type deflector plays the guide effect to the spacing armature of spring bolt, makes the spacing armature of spring bolt carry out rectilinear motion, restricts the lateral displacement of the spacing armature of spring bolt.
Furthermore, the spring bolt limiting inclined pin and the spring bolt limiting armature are both provided with inclined planes, and friction force is generated between the spring bolt limiting inclined pin and the spring bolt limiting armature through contact between the inclined planes, so that the limiting effect is achieved. The inclined plane increases the friction between the lock tongue limiting inclined pin and the lock tongue limiting armature, so that the bicycle is locked more firmly.
The working principle of the invention is as follows:
locking a vehicle: the locking plate fixed on the public leasing bicycle is inserted into the locking groove to generate force for enabling the locking bolt to rotate clockwise, the locking bolt rotates clockwise through the rotary pin, the locking plate is in place, meanwhile, the locking plate triggers the limit switch to be closed, a user uses the IC card to swipe the card in the IC card area, the ECU control system receives signals, the ECU control system controls the push-pull electromagnetic valve to push the locking bolt limit armature to move, the locking bolt limit oblique pin contacts with the locking bolt limit armature, interaction force is generated between the locking bolt limit oblique pin and the locking bolt limit armature, the locking bolt limit armature is located at a locking position through the interaction force, the displacement of the locking bolt limit oblique pin is limited, and the bicycle is in a locking state.
And (3) maintaining: the external force action makes the lock plate generate force for the lock plate to rotate clockwise, the lock plate limit oblique pin and the lock plate limit armature generate interaction force, the friction force between the lock plate limit armature and the support plate is increased by the action force, and the lock plate limit armature is kept motionless to play a locking role.
Unlocking: the user uses the IC card to swipe the card in the IC card area again, the ECU control system receives a signal, the ECU control system controls the push-pull electromagnetic valve to push the lock tongue limiting armature to move in the opposite direction, the lock tongue limiting oblique pin is separated from the lock tongue limiting armature, the interaction force between the lock tongue limiting oblique pin and the lock tongue limiting armature disappears, the lock tongue limiting armature is positioned at the unlocking position, the lock tongue can rotate clockwise, the limiting switch is connected, the bicycle is in the unlocking state, and the user separates the lock sheet of the public leasing bicycle from the lock groove.
Wherein the limit switch acts as: only if the locking plate is completely in place, the limit switch is closed, and the IC card can be used for functioning.

Example 1:
as shown in fig. 1-4, an intelligent lock structure for a public rental bicycle is arranged in a bicycle fixing column of a parking place of the public rental bicycle, the bicycle fixing column is provided with an IC card area and an ECU control system, the IC card area is electrically connected with the ECU control system, the public rental bicycle is provided with a lock plate 4 on a front wheel fork, the intelligent lock structure is provided with a support plate 1, a lock tongue 2, a lock tongue limiting oblique pin 3, a limit switch 5, a lock tongue limiting armature 6 and a push-pull electromagnetic valve 7, the lock tongue limiting armature 6 is connected with the push-pull electromagnetic valve 7, the push-pull electromagnetic valve 7 is fixed on the support plate 1 and electrically connected with the ECU control system, the lock tongue 2 is provided with a support rod 21, the lock tongue 2 is connected with the support plate 1 through a support rod 21, the lock tongue 2 is movably connected with the support rod 21 through a rotary pin 22, the lock tongue limiting oblique pin 3 is fixedly connected with the lock tongue 2, the limit switch 4 is arranged on the bicycle fixing column, the lock tongue 2 is provided with a boss 23, the boss 23 is provided with a lock groove 24, and the lock plate 4 is inserted into the lock groove 24 to lock the public rental bicycle.
Wherein the limit switch 5 acts as: only if the locking plate 4 is completely in position, the limit switch 5 is closed, and the IC card can be used for functioning.
Wherein, a spring 8 is also arranged between the lock tongue 2 and the support plate 1. The spring 8 plays a role in keeping the lock tongue 2 in a keeping state; the U-shaped guide plate 9 is arranged on the support plate 1, and the U-shaped guide plate 8 plays a guide role on the lock tongue limiting armature 6, so that the lock tongue limiting armature 6 moves linearly and the transverse displacement of the lock tongue limiting armature 6 is limited; the spring bolt limiting inclined pin 3 and the spring bolt limiting armature 6 are both provided with inclined planes, friction force is generated by contact between the spring bolt limiting inclined pin 3 and the spring bolt limiting armature 6 through the inclined planes, so that the limiting effect is achieved, and the friction force between the spring bolt limiting inclined pin 3 and the spring bolt limiting armature 6 is increased by the inclined planes, so that the bicycle is locked more firmly.
And (3) analyzing a specific working principle:
locking a vehicle: the locking plate 4 fixed on the public leasing bicycle is inserted into the locking groove 24 to generate force for enabling the locking bolt 2 to rotate clockwise, the locking bolt 2 rotates clockwise through the rotary pin 22, the locking plate 4 is in place, the spring 8 enables the locking bolt 2 to keep in contact with the locking plate 4, meanwhile, the locking plate triggers the limit switch 5 to be closed, a user uses an IC card to swipe the card in the IC card area, the ECU control system receives signals, the ECU control system controls the push-pull electromagnetic valve 7 to push the locking bolt limit armature 6 to move, the U-shaped guide plate 9 plays a guiding role on the locking bolt limit armature 6, the locking bolt limit oblique pin 3 contacts with the locking bolt limit armature 6, interaction force is generated between the locking bolt limit oblique pin 3 and the locking bolt limit armature 6, the locking bolt limit oblique pin 3 is limited to move by the locking force, and the bicycle is in a locking state.
And (3) maintaining: the external force action makes the locking plate 4 generate a force for enabling the locking plate 2 to rotate clockwise on the locking plate 2, the inclined plane between the locking plate limiting inclined pin 3 and the locking plate limiting armature 6 generates an interaction force, the friction force between the locking plate limiting armature 6 and the supporting plate 1 is increased by the action force, and the locking plate limiting armature 6 is kept motionless to play a locking role.
Unlocking: the user uses the IC card again to punch the card in the IC card area, the ECU control system receives the signal, the ECU control system controls the push-pull electromagnetic valve 7 to push the lock tongue limiting armature 6 to move in the opposite direction, the lock tongue limiting oblique pin 3 is separated from the inclined plane of the lock tongue limiting armature 6, the interaction force between the lock tongue limiting oblique pin 3 and the inclined plane of the lock tongue limiting armature 6 disappears, the lock tongue limiting armature 6 is in the unlocking position, the lock tongue 2 can rotate clockwise, the limit switch 5 is turned on, the bicycle is in the unlocking state, and the user separates the lock sheet 4 of the public leasing bicycle from the lock groove 24.
